With the home course advantage on their side, the Pleasantville girls golf team outgunned squads from nearby Knoxville and Pella High to win a triangular Monday night at the Pleasantville Country Club. The Trojans shot a combined 193; 18 strokes in front of second-place Pella High. Knoxville carded a 248.

The Pleasantville girls swept the individual honors as well, with Morgan Marsh firing a 43 as individual medalist, and Ashley Jahner’s 46 garnering runner-up honors. Pella High’s low round came from Rachel Dursky, who shot a 49. Knoxville’s Jessica Weldon carded the low round for the Panthers with a 54.
